Basic Fall Pruning — Tips and Techniques

Trees growing wild? Shrubbery getting out of hand? Join Ellyn Shea, International Society of Arboriculture Certified Arborist, and learn the fundamentals of pruning at this special lecture and workshop.

Ellyn will discuss professional pruning technique, touching on early training of small trees, methods for mature trees and woody shrubs, basic tree biology and growth, and proper use and care of pruning tools. The group will also examine some containerized plants and discuss how to inspect nursery stock for quality.

Ellyn Shea has spent a decade in the green industry, working with Friends of the Urban Forest for eight years,and currently with local consulting arborist Roy Leggitt.
